Alonso Delivers Monza Masterclass

Fernando Alonso trimmed McLaren team-mate Lewis Hamilton’s title advantage to just three points by delivering a Monza masterclass in the Italian Grand Prix.

The world champion stamped his authority on the race from the off and was never challenged en route to his first win at the historic venue and his fourth victory of 2007.

Hamilton was unable to match Alonso’s pace but protected his points lead by putting a bold pass on Kimi Raikkonen after the Ferrari driver used a one-stop strategy to leapfrog the rookie following his second pit visit.

The 1-2 result was the best possible tonic for the beleaguered McLaren team on a traumatic weekend in which the latest developments in the spying controversy threatened to reduce the race to a mere sideshow.

Alonso Takes Pole Position Ahead of Team-mate Lewis Hamilton

Fernando Alonso underlined the superiority he has enjoyed all weekend at Monza by dominating qualifying to head up an all-McLaren front row for the Italian Grand Prix.

The world champion ultimately took pole position by just 0.037s from team-mate Lewis Hamilton, but his true advantage was disguised by the fact that he aborted his final run once it became clear that he could not be beaten.

Mercedes-Benz Continues to Post Record Sales

Stuttgart – Sales of Mercedes Car Group passenger vehicles rose by nine percent in August 2007 to a record 96,200 units (August 2006: 88,600 units). As a result, sales of Mercedes-Benz, Maybach and smart brand vehicles amount to 817,600 units for the first eight months of the year (January-August 2006: 818,200). The Mercedes-Benz brand also set a new record for the month of August by delivering 89,100 vehicles to customers, which represents a nine percent increase from August 2006 (81,700). At 758,600 units, sales of Mercedes-Benz vehicles were also at an all-time high for the first eight months of the year, up three percent from the same period last year (January-August 2006: 739,800).

New Mercedes-Benz SLK 55 AMG Black Series: It’s Time to Fly

The famous F1 or SLR lookalike nose has finally justified its appearance. Well, it could be a potential überflieger, a car that Porsche drivers won’t make happy at all.

After shifting the CLK63 AMG into overdrive with the Black Series treatment, Mercedes is repeating the process, this time with the SLK55 AMG. Thanks to a massaged 5.5-liter V-8 that now makes 400 horsepower and 383 pound-feet of torque — up 40 and 7, respectively — and lightweight components that shave 99 pounds off the car’s weight, the SLK55 AMG Black Series goes 0-62 in 4.5 seconds — 0.4 second quicker than the regular SLK 55 — with a top speed of 173 mph.

The Magnificent 19

Mercedes-Benz’s director of corporate communications, Geoff Day, announced a great event for the upcoming Frankfurt auto show: Mercedes-Benz will be introducing 19 cars in 15 minutes.

These won’t all be new cars, with probably a mix of concepts and updates, but Mercedes-Benz intends to make a big splash this year. We expect to see some sort of hybrid in the mix, although we couldn’t pin him down on the details. The most firm information we got was the previously leaked F700 concept, rumored to be a big luxury car, which will feature the DiesOtto engine.
